Gastrointestinal - Peptic Ulcer Disease


Listen Later

In this episode, we review peptic ulcer disease (PUD) with a practical, clinically focused approach. We cover underlying pathophysiology, key risk factors—including H. pylori and NSAID use—classic symptoms, and important complications such as bleeding and perforation. The discussion highlights diagnostic strategies, evidence-based treatment, and prevention pearls to help clinicians confidently evaluate and manage patients with upper GI complaints.
